York Beach is a town in York County, Maine, United States at the southwest corner of the state. Being located on the gulf of Maine, just beside the Atlanta Ocean, it is a well-known summer resort. York has a council-manager form of government.Geographically it is located at 4309’48” north and 70038’55” west. It covers an area of 57.7 square miles out of which 54.9 square mile is covered by land and the rest 2.8 square miles is covered by water. It rises about 190 ft above sea level.The city’s total population is 12,854 with a population density of 234.1/sq mile. As of the 2000 census there were 5.235 households and 3,690 families residing in the town. The per capita income of the town is $ 30,895.Originally York was called Agamenticus which means “behind the hill little cove”, the Abenaki name for the York River. In 1638 it was renamed as Bristol by the settlers who migrated from Bristol, England.
